Lift Heavy Run Fast is the podcast for athletes who want to get stronger, faster, and fitter by combining strength and endurance training in an evidence-based way. Host Jeroen van der Mark explores the science of hybrid performance with leading researchers, coaches, and high-performing athletes. Topics include strength adaptation, hypertrophy, energy systems, metabolic conditioning, lactate thresholds, recovery physiology, nutrition, and mental resilience. Each episode breaks down complex research into clear, actionable strategies you can apply to your training—whether you’re in the gym, on the track, in the mountains, or preparing for HYROX, triathlon, or a strength-focused race.       In this episode of Lift Heavy Run Fast, host Jeroen van der Mark sits down with Dutch ultra-athlete and physiotherapist Xander Bijsterveld, who recently completed an extreme 100 km ultratrail in the Swiss Alps with 6250 meters of elevation gain.

      We dive into his full preparation: training structure, pacing, nutrition, tendon management, and how he stays strong while pushing his endurance to the limit. Xander continues to hit PRs in the gym while taking on brutal mountain ultras — how is that even possible?

      Topics

      • Was this the hardest challenge Xander has ever done?
      • How he structured his training for a 100 km with massive elevation
      • Flat ultras vs. mountain ultras: what’s the difference?
      • How to prep for elevation when you live in a flat country
      • Managing tendon load, niggles and accumulated fatigue
      • How he tapered into race week
      • Xander’s full nutrition strategy (carbs, fluids, electrolytes)
      • His pacing approach for a 10+ hour effort
      • Common mistakes ultra athletes make
      • How he recovered physically and mentally
